HONEYWELL MTL4850 – HART Multiplexer for Smart Instrument Access and Asset Management

The HONEYWELL MTL4850 is designed to aggregate HART data from multiple 4–20 mA field instruments and deliver it to an asset management or maintenance system over a simple serial link. It typically lets you unlock device diagnostics, secondary variables, and configuration without disturbing the control loop or re-terminating existing I/O. In many cases, it’s the cleanest way to add HART visibility plantwide without ripping up the cabinet.

Key Features
  • Non-intrusive HART access – Taps the HART signal from live 4–20 mA loops so control remains unaffected during commissioning and maintenance.

  • Multi-channel aggregation – Consolidates data from many HART devices into a single serial connection, which is ideal for larger cabinets and multi-skid systems.

  • Host connectivity via RS-485/Modbus RTU – Appears as standard registers to most asset management platforms and CMMS tools, making integration straightforward.

  • Works with mixed-vendor instruments – HART is vendor-neutral; you can typically pull status, PV/SV/TV/QV, and device diagnostics from different brands on the same multiplexer.

  • Cabinet-friendly form factor – From my experience, it fits comfortably into standard control panels and marshalling racks with minimal wiring disruption.

  • Scalable architecture – Expand channel capacity in stages as new loops are added, instead of a large one-time changeout.

  • LED status and addressing – You might notice that simple visual indicators and address selection make setup and fault finding faster during startup.

Application Fields

Plants that already rely on 4–20 mA with HART stand to benefit the most. I typically see the MTL4850 used in:

  • Oil & Gas and Petrochemical – Device health monitoring across large marshalling rooms without touching the DCS I/O.

  • Chemicals and Specialty Materials – Remote configuration and loop-check support during turnarounds.

  • Power Generation – Consolidated access to valve positioners and transmitters for predictive maintenance.

  • Water/Wastewater – Centralized diagnostics for distributed pump stations and skids.

  • Pharma and Food – Non-intrusive access helps protect validated control logic while enabling smart-instrument insights.

Installation & Maintenance
  • Cabinet standards – Mount in a clean, dry control cabinet. Provide stable 24 V DC power and keep wiring segregated: analog loops separate from RS‑485 where feasible.

  • Wiring practice – Use twisted, shielded pairs for RS‑485. Terminate and bias the bus correctly at the ends; keep a single-point shield ground to minimize noise.

  • Loop tapping – Connect to the HART signal across the analog loop per the wiring diagram. It appears that non-intrusive tap points maintain loop integrity.

  • Addressing and setup – Set the Modbus address and baud rate as required by the host. Many teams prefer fixed addressing to simplify documentation.

  • Routine maintenance – Periodically verify communication health (HART SNR, retries), clean dust from vents, and back up configuration. Firmware updates may be available through the vendor when applicable.

  • Safety – De-energize loops if you need to change terminations. Follow standard lockout/tagout practices and site grounding policies.
